Chapter 3 Collision

China Overseas Technology University and Haisha Normal University are both built at the foot of the Yunlu Mountain. From the University of Technology to Normal University, you will walk along the Xiangjiang River and pass through a small street that is basically parallel to the Xiangjiang River. This is the famous Xiushui Street in Haisha City.

There are mainly small restaurants on both sides of the street. Because college students coming here from all over the country have a large number of visitors, there are snacks that combine all kinds of flavors. Whenever night falls, looking around, the whole street is almost filled with all kinds of food, and the prices are very cheap, and every stall will be filled with students.

In addition, there are also many places that college students like for consumer groups, such as houses, audio and video stores, boutique stores, grocery stores, Internet cafes, kTVs, etc.

The dusk gradually became heavier, and the lights were lit one by one. From a distance, the winding streets were like colorful light belts, intertwined among the passing crowds.

The window glass is extremely transparent, and the lights are like direct shots in the eyes, reflecting blur.

Outside the street sidewalk, in the light and shadow of the orange street lights, a petite girl with a bud head combed. She looked around and looked down at the bright mobile phone screen. Her clear eyes were covered with bangs, and the corners of her mouth were cute and grinning...

"Anzi, where is it?"

Lin An woke up, his vision was clear, and there were only bustling people passing by on the sidewalks on the streets. He withdrew his gaze and looked at the fork in front of him, thought for a while, and then pointed to the residential community a little further to the right.

Seeing that Zhou Changshun was following Lin An's command, he drove the car to a place to turn off the engine and stopped. Zhao Xiaobing, who was sitting in the rear car, said in surprise, "Lin An, you are very familiar with this place."

Another slightly fat young man also looked at Lin An. The parking space of the van happened to be a slope road blocked by street lights. From the angle of the car window, he saw the entry and exit of the two residential communities in his eyes.

"I have been here with... my friends before." Lin An looked at the lights in front of him, thinking about the figure that just appeared in front of him, and his heart was pounding. There was a little difference between here and a few years later, but there was not much change. After that, it is said that all of them are demolished.

Feng Yongliang is a fugitive and will try to avoid appearing in public, let alone go to places where identity certificates are required. This is a residential community. Because there are many college students nearby, there are many cheap rental houses and very liquidity.

After seeing the surrounding environment, the two young men in the rear car could not help but feel more hope.

Such cheap rental houses rarely come with their own kitchens. If Feng Yongliang is in his identity, he should not cook very much, let alone being absconded. Next to it is the bustling Xiushui Street. There are basically no restaurants or snack bars in the two residential communities. If you want to eat at Xiushui Street from here, you will inevitably appear from the perspective of a van.

Zhou Changshun's hotel is quite famous in Lingshui Town. Feng Yongliang occasionally greets guests there, so he naturally knows Zhou Chang. As for the two in the back of the car, they are police officers from the town police station. They have seen Feng Yongliang, but they are not sure whether Feng Yongliang has an impression of them.

In order to ensure insurance, so as not to accidentally reveal one's identity and be alarmed, the responsibility of buying food and drinks fell on Lin An's shoulders. After all, Feng Yongliang's possibility of knowing Lin An is extremely small.

As the night passed, there was no sign of Feng Yongliang, including Zhou Changshun, all three people gradually became anxious. During this period, they also urged Lin An to call and ask "classmate" again to see if he could contact the so-called "brother". After hearing Lin An reply, he became even more anxious.

The next evening, Zhao Xiaobing sat in the cab to monitor the entrances and exits of two communities. Zhou Changshun and the slightly fat young man were about to take over the evening shift, so he stayed in the back seat of the carriage to rest.

After guarding for a while, seeing that there was still no sign of Feng Yongliang, Lin An looked at the time and whispered to Zhao Xiaobing that he would go to Xiushui Street to buy dinner for everyone.

When the lights are on, it is the time when there are many students on Xiushui Street.

Lin An walked across the street and glanced at the van. To be honest, he felt a little anxious. Perhaps because most of the "future" memories disappeared after waking up, he himself gradually became shaken.

What if, if those are really just a long and too realistic dream?

The night wind blew, Lin An tightened his coat, thought of clearly leaving those memories, and shook his head awake again.

Compared to the other three, there is another reason for his anxiety. Whether the key figure in this case can appear shakes his doubts about whether this is a "dream" or "returning to the past".

Zhou Changshun and the other two had a box lunch. Lin An had no appetite. After a round trip, he ordered a portion of soup noodles.

Carrying the lunch box and carefully holding the hot soup noodles in the other hand, Lin An was about to arrive on the streets of Xiushui Street, and suddenly heard a lot of shouts coming from the front, and then the crowd on the road spread like water waves.

I saw a tall and burly bald middle-aged man rushed towards me. While shouting in anger, he waved the shiny steel pipes picked up from somewhere. When pedestrians on the street saw it, they screamed and hid on both sides.

Feng Yongliang, it is Feng Yongliang!

Lin An recognized the middle-aged man at a glance. Along the distance, Zhao Xiaobing and a slightly fat young man rushed to chase him. While they showed their ID to the crowd who were frightened and hid on both sides, they shouted that Feng Yongliang should stop, while Zhou Changshun ran to the end.

In an instant, Lin An's palm was filled with sweat, looking at Feng Yongliang who was getting closer and closer.

Feng Yongliang is burly and strong, and it has always been rumored to be a thug in Lingshui Town. When Feng Yongliang was young, he was a thug.

Lin An, who is only fifteen years old this year, seems too fragile compared to Feng Yongliang. He rushed up to block the car rashly, and it was undoubtedly a mantis arm to block the car. However, if he did not block it, the other side of Xiushui Street leads to the Normal University campus. Once people enter, it will be difficult to find them again!

And after this, Feng Yongliang is likely to disappear into the sea sand. By then, he will not be able to find someone by "prophet", that is, there is only one chance.

There are so many people on the street, and Zhao Xiaobing and the other two were so far away by Feng Yongliang, they were about to chase him. If Feng Yongliang could not be caught today, the truth would not be revealed in more than ten years.

Feng Yongliang's face was ferocious, and he shouted and ran with great strides. The crowded on the road screamed in surprise and fled in chaos.

It seemed that the back, who was obviously middle-aged but old aged a lot many years later, appeared in front of me. Lin An threw away the fried rice he was holding, slowed down and hid towards the roadside with the crowd around him. The cup of soup noodles he was holding was lifted, and after he lifted the lid, he steamed out.

Seeing Feng Yongliang rushing in front of him, Lin An stretched out his arm, turned around and forcefully, smashing the soup powder in his hand over, then avoiding the splashing soup on his back, aiming his toes at the joints of his side knees, and hitting him horizontally.

The huge impact of the return almost made Lin An vomit, and then he felt like he was in the air. Subconsciously, he completed a series of movements of protecting his legs and elbows.

His body fell to the ground, rolled out a few times and stopped. He didn't care about the pain, so he hurriedly turned around and looked over.

As he was screaming, Feng Yongliang staggered and supported the wall, smearing the heat on his face, and was then kicked by Zhao Xiaobing who rushed over.

Then Zhou Changshun and the others arrived, and together with Zhao Xiaobing, they pressed down Feng Yongliang, who was still struggling hard.

The crowd gathered far away, and it seemed that someone wanted to catch the phone booth next to him to call the police. Zhou Changshun hurriedly took out his ID from Zhao Xiaobing's pocket, illuminated the crowd around him, and made a mistake in the reason for catching the thief. In this way, the commotion in half of the street gradually stopped.

Feng Yongliang's arm was handcuffed, afraid that he would yell around, and when Zhou Changshun and the slightly fat young man pulled out the belt to tie him up, Zhao Xiaobing kept pressing his head to the ground.

After being pressed tightly and his arms were tied up, Feng Yongliang finally stopped struggling meaninglessly. Suddenly, he turned his head by struggling again.

Facing Feng Yongliang's eyes glaring towards him, Lin An turned his face and looked at the night sky reflected by lights on the street, smiling relievedly. It was really not just a dream, but the inexplicable uneasiness in his heart dissipated!

Until Feng Yongliang appeared, he still had doubts about the world he returned to. Now, this doubt has finally been dispelled.

it hurts!

Lin An was about to sit down, but his whole body was sore, so he continued to lie on the ground, gasping for breath.

Such a body cannot do it!
